""" Here we want to invert the words in a string, without reverting
|
||||
the words.
|
||||
|
||||
Important things to remember:
|
||||
|
||||
1. python strings are immutable
|
||||
2. The last word doesn't not end by a space, so we need to make
|
||||
sure we get the last word too
|
||||
|
||||
The solution consists of two loops,
|
||||
1) revert all the characters with 2 pointers
|
||||
2) search for spaces and revert the words, two pointers too
|
||||
3) You can represent space as ' ' or as u'\u0020'
|
||||
4) Do we want to look to ! ; , . etc?
|
||||
|
||||
In the solutions bellow, we show how to do this logic, and how to use
|
||||
python's methods to do in a few lines
|
||||
"""
